EDUCATION NEWS

  • Temple College will begin demolishing five campus buildings on Saturday as part of a major redevelopment funded by a $124.9 million bond approved in 2021—Cloud Construction will shut off power on the west side for eight hours while new facilities continue to be constructed.  KCEN-TV
  • Killeen ISD has named 10 experienced educators as principals for the 2025-26 school year; Dr. Bobbie Reeders will remain at Roy J. Smith Middle School while nine other appointees lead one high school, six middle schools, three elementary schools and one specialty high school+ the district said the placements reflect its commitment to student success.  KXXV

GOVERNMENT NEWS

  • Children’s Advocacy Center of Central Texas cut the ribbon for its first satellite office on Fort Cavazos on June 5, making it the first children’s advocacy center on a military installation. The center—formed in a partnership with the Office of Special Trial Counsel and U.S. Army Criminal Investigation Division—will offer forensic interviews and support services for military children and families.  KCEN-TV
